Description

Read more










Chu explores the significance of the Summer Olympic medal haul for relations between Beijing and Taipei, and between Beijing and Hong Kong. Chu asks what significance these victories had for each of the three governments as well as for the relations of Taipei and Hong Kong with Beijing.

List of contents

1.Introduction 2. China’s Olympic Medal Haul: Los Angeles 1984 – Sydney 2000 3.China’s Olympic Medal Haul: Athens 2004 – Tokyo 2020 4.Chinese Taipei’s Olympic Medal Haul: Los Angeles 1984 – Atlanta 1996 5. Chinese Taipei’s Olympic Medal Haul: Sydney 2000 – Tokyo 2020 6.Hong Kong and Hong Kong, China’s Olympic Medal Haul 7.Conclusion

About the author

Marcus P. Chu is assistant professor in the Department of Government and International Affairs at Lingnan University, Hong Kong.
